黑狐家游戏

深度解析分布式存储技术,架构、优势与挑战,什么是分布式存储技术

欧气 1 0

本文目录导读:

  1. 分布式存储技术架构
  2. 分布式存储技术优势
  3. 分布式存储技术挑战

随着大数据、云计算等技术的飞速发展,数据存储需求日益增长,分布式存储技术作为一种新兴的存储解决方案,逐渐成为企业构建海量数据存储系统的首选,本文将深入探讨分布式存储技术的架构、优势、挑战及其应用前景。

分布式存储技术架构

1、数据分片

深度解析分布式存储技术,架构、优势与挑战,什么是分布式存储技术

图片来源于网络,如有侵权联系删除

分布式存储技术首先将数据按照一定规则进行分片,将大量数据分散存储在多个节点上,数据分片可以提高数据的读写性能,降低单节点存储压力,实现数据的高可用性。

2、节点通信

节点通信是分布式存储技术的核心组成部分,通过节点之间的通信,可以实现数据的同步、复制、迁移等操作,常用的节点通信协议有:Gossip协议、Raft协议、Paxos协议等。

3、存储引擎

存储引擎负责数据的存储、读取、更新等操作,常见的存储引擎有:HDFS(Hadoop Distributed File System)、Ceph、GlusterFS等。

4、管理与监控

分布式存储系统需要一套完善的管理与监控机制,以便实时了解系统运行状态、性能指标等信息,常见的管理系统有:Ambari、Cloudera Manager、Red Hat Storage Console等。

分布式存储技术优势

1、高性能

分布式存储技术通过数据分片和节点通信,实现数据的并行处理,提高数据读写性能,通过冗余存储,降低数据访问延迟。

深度解析分布式存储技术,架构、优势与挑战,什么是分布式存储技术

图片来源于网络,如有侵权联系删除

2、高可用性

分布式存储系统采用冗余存储机制,确保数据不因单点故障而丢失,在节点故障时,系统可自动进行数据恢复,保证系统高可用性。

3、高扩展性

分布式存储系统可根据需求动态调整存储容量,满足海量数据存储需求,在数据量增长时,只需增加节点即可实现线性扩展。

4、良好的兼容性

分布式存储技术支持多种存储协议,如NFS、SMB、iSCSI等,方便与其他存储系统进行集成。

分布式存储技术挑战

1、数据一致性

分布式存储系统在保证数据一致性的同时,需要兼顾性能和可用性,如何平衡这三者之间的关系,是分布式存储技术面临的挑战之一。

2、网络延迟与带宽

深度解析分布式存储技术,架构、优势与挑战,什么是分布式存储技术

图片来源于网络,如有侵权联系删除

节点之间的网络延迟和带宽会影响数据传输效率,在分布式存储系统中,如何优化网络传输,降低延迟和带宽消耗,是技术难题。

3、节点管理

分布式存储系统涉及大量节点,节点管理难度较大,如何实现高效、便捷的节点管理,是分布式存储技术面临的挑战之一。

4、安全性问题

分布式存储系统需要保证数据的安全性,防止数据泄露、篡改等风险,如何实现数据加密、访问控制等功能,是分布式存储技术需要关注的问题。

分布式存储技术作为一种新兴的存储解决方案,具有高性能、高可用性、高扩展性等优势,在实现过程中也面临着数据一致性、网络延迟、节点管理、安全性等问题,随着技术的不断发展,相信分布式存储技术将不断完善,为海量数据存储提供更加可靠、高效的解决方案。

标签: #分布式存储技术

黑狐家游戏
  • 评论列表

留言评论